Motive raises USD 2.54bn across Fund 2 and co-investment vehicles

US-headquartered technology-enabled financial and business services investor Motive Partners has raised USD 2.54bn via a final close for Motive Capital Fund 2 and its affiliated co-investment vehicles.

Cinven holds EUR 1.5bn final close for financial services fund

Cinven has held a EUR 1.5bn final close for its Strategic Financials Fund (SFF), marking the GP’s debut vehicle in a strategy that will focuses exclusively on financial services investments.

Mubadala leads equity raise in Wefox's USD 400m Series D

Berlin-based insurtech platform Wefox has reached a USD 4.5bn valuation in a Series D round backed by existing investors, with sovereign wealth fund Mubadala leading the equity raise.

August Equity to target GBP 400m in fundraise for upcoming sixth fund

UK-focused sponsor August Equity will look to raise its sixth fund towards the end of the year with a target of around GBP 400m, a source familiar with the situation told Unquote.

Partners Group hires ZF’s Scheider as head of private equity

Partners Group has appointed Wolf-Henning Scheider, the departing CEO of auto supplier ZF, as partner and head of its private equity department.

Scale Capital eyes EUR 70m-100m for new VC fund by year-end

Danish VC firm Scale Capital is on the market fundraising for its third fund targeting at least EUR 70m by the end of the year, managing partner Lars Jensen said.

Hg to launch sale of business messaging group Commify

Hg has appointed Moelis to sell Commify, a UK-based business communications services group, three sources familiar with the situation said.

Siparex holds EUR 450m final close for ETI 5

France-headquartered GP Siparex has held a EUR 450m final close for ETI 5, its latest fund dedicated to medium-sized companies.

Mobeus reaps 4.4x money, 64% IRR on Access Partnership MBO to Mayfair

Mobeus Equity Partners has exited Access Partnership, a provider of technology advisory in the fields of regulation and public policy, in a management buyout backed by Mayfair Equity.

Equistone weighs auction for United Initiators

Equistone is weighing a sale of specialty chemicals supplier United Initiators, three sources familiar with the matter said.

Erhvervsinvest gears up for Fund V final close in 9-12 months

Danish small-to-mid cap investor Erhvervsinvest is aiming for a final close of its fifth private equity fund in the next nine to 12 months, Managing Partner Thomas Marstrand said.

Novum places MMC Studios in continuation fund

Novum Capital has put MMC Studios, a German film and television production company, into a continuation fund after initially exploring a sale, according to two sources familiar with the situation.

Eurazeo reaps 3.7x money on Orolia exit to trade

Eurazeo has closed the sale of its majority stake in Orolia to aircraft parts manufacturer Safran in a deal that generated cash proceeds of EUR 189m.

CapMan exits Fortaco, buys Netox

Finnish private equity firm CapMan Buyout has exited local industrial group Fortaco to One Equity Partners while also acquiring cybersecurity group Netox.

Perwyn hires CFO from Silverfleet Capital

Perwyn, a UK-based family-backed private and growth equity investor, has appointed James Gavey as its new CFO.

Superangel targets up to EUR 50m hard cap for second fund

Estonian venture capital firm Superangel is aiming for a hard cap of up to EUR 50m for its second fund following its announcement last month, general partner Marko Oolo told Unquote.

Apax heads for second small-cap fund with EUR 350m target

Paris-based sponsor Apax Partners is getting ready to launch its second small-cap private equity fund due to hit the market for fundraising before the end of the year.

Mayfair exits Talon in SBO to Equistone

Consumer and technology investor Mayfair Equity Partners has agreed to fully exit portfolio company Talon Outdoor to Equistone; the company’s management will retain a meaningful stake.
